The cheapest way to get from Cornish Seal Sanctuary to Penzance is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 30 min.
The fastest way to get from Cornish Seal Sanctuary to Penzance is to taxi which takes 30 min and costs £35 - £50.
No, there is no direct bus from Cornish Seal Sanctuary to Penzance station. However, there are services departing from Gweek Quay and arriving at Bus Station via Blue Anchor.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 6m.
The distance between Cornish Seal Sanctuary and Penzance is 24 miles. The road distance is 17.9 miles.
